Alain Guiraudie
Born 1964 · Villefranche-de-Rouergue, Aveyron, France
Alain Guiraudie (born July 15, 1964), is the son of a farming family in Villefranche-de-Rouergue in the southwest of France, where most of his films are set. His most successful film to date, Stranger by the Lake, won the Best Director Award in Un Certain Regard at Cannes as well as the Queer Palm. Also a novelist, he published his debut title “Ici commence la nuit” in 2014. His film Staying Vertical screened in competition at the 2016 Cannes film festival.
